How many years does it take to become a professional boxer? This varies widely, but generally, one can expect to spend at least 4 to 5 years in amateur boxing before considering turning professional. This timeline can be shorter or longer based on individual talent, effort, and circumstances. While the costs of a professional boxer licence can vary, applicants can look to spend at least £1000 in total costs of applying for a licence. For those who are extra lucky and get an invitation to partake in regional or national title matches, there could be a $10,000 to $50,000 check.
